Publisher. Impossible delete, move, etc. an image layer

Right know i'm trying to make a manual and when added images to my new project sometimes app blocks that image layer and can't do anything with it, the only that i can do to solve this is "undo". Can you help me please?

The right-click options have hidden the Layers panel, so it's hard to be sure, but it looks like the layer you're trying to adjust is inherited from a Master Page.

If so, some edits must be made either:

(a) on the Master Page; or

(b) after right-clicking on the Master Page's layer on the document page's Layers panel and choosing "Edit Detached".

Approach (a) applies the change to all the document pages that inherit from the Master Page. Approach (b) applies the change to just one document page.
